It was the Polaris competition that first introduced me to the French Canadian band called Malajube. Since then my relationship with them went from mild interest - to true love. The pictures in this post are from their November 4, 2006 CMJ/FADER show that officially sealed the deal. On February 18th they're coming back to NYC to play Mercury Lounge with Snowden. The next day they play Southpaw in Brooklyn (Ra Ra Riot also on that bill). In March they're playing SXSW. All tour dates below...
